This was my first time staying at a chain 'upscale hostel' in Beijing, and overall, it was a pretty good experience. I saw an ad for it on the subway. Here are my thoughts on a few points: ① It opened in 2026, so all the facilities are brand new, and the price is decent. However, their WeChat mini-program is terrible; it often lags when loading. How am I supposed to use it? They really need to fix their mini-program! I even became a member, but the membership benefits on the official mini-program aren't compatible with platforms like Ctrip. This meant that membership perks (like late check-out until 2 PM) weren't recognized by the hotel when I booked through Ctrip. They value the platform, not the person, which is ridiculous... ② Convenient transportation: It's very close to Xiaobeiying Road bus station, just a minute or two walk. It's about a 10-minute walk to Datun Road East subway station. There are plenty of shared bikes outside the hotel. ③ Daily necessities and food: There's a small convenience store right outside the entrance with basic items. Just a few steps away, you'll find snack stalls in Tiangongyuan, making breakfast and lunch easy to sort out. ④ My single room had a sachet, and the air conditioning was powerful. The door closed automatically, and the bedside outlets were well-placed. However, the bedside lighting control didn't include the main ceiling light, so I had to get up and walk to the door to turn it off. The same goes for the air conditioning, which is a bit inconvenient. ⑤ It's great that the vending machine in the lobby sells laundry detergent, shower gel, shampoo, and toothbrush sets, all in small bottles. There's also a water dispenser with paper cups. They even provide umbrellas for a 50 RMB deposit, which is very handy. ⑥ Regarding the laundry room: The front desk provides free laundry bags and can even help collect washed clothes, which is very thoughtful. However, I encountered someone washing shoes, which really grossed me out. This is truly frustrating and depends on people's personal素质 (sense of public etiquette). They really need to enforce fines and catch people in the act. I also saw underwear in the laundry baskets (I hope they were waiting to be hand-washed). Sigh, people shouldn't put their intimates and shoes in communal washing machines... The hotel really needs to rigorously disinfect the machines; don't let down my trust in your excellent chain hostel brand! Also, there were a lot of flies and small bugs in the laundry room? I have no idea where they came from, but they were gone the next day, so I guess it was cleaned up. I suggest the front desk gets an electric fly swatter. For these situations, physical methods are quick, effective, low-cost, and chemical-free, making them very safe. ⑦ The shower curtain in the bathroom is simply a design flaw. You have to touch it every time you enter or exit (and people's hands can be dry, wet, or unwashed after using the toilet), and I doubt the curtain is ever cleaned. But the bathroom faces the corridor directly, so they can't leave it uncovered. I wonder how it was designed. Many people leave toothpaste, toothbrushes, clothes, etc., on the counter or in the shower, and no one collects or removes them. I suggest putting up a sign to remind people and regularly cleaning up; if items aren't taken, just discard them! The bathroom itself was cleaned quite well. ⑧ The shower water temperature fluctuates wildly! It happened every time. I even made sure to go when no one else was around to avoid water competition, but it still went hot and cold... I suspect that if someone uses the other side (men's or women's shower room), it significantly affects the water temperature, including the hot water at the sink. Thumbs down! ⑨ The internet is unstable. I guess when more people stay, they all compete for bandwidth. The signal shows full bars, but the speed is slow or it can't connect. There's almost no internet in the bathroom (both Wi-Fi and mobile data are very weak, no 5G, 4G is available but unusable for both China Telecom and China Mobile – and I'm not even an iPhone user; I imagine it would be worse on an iPhone). They need to expand Wi-Fi coverage, install more routers, and optimize it. The internet is a big drawback! Other points: The soundproofing isn't great; you can hear the washing machine. Wearing earplugs isn't a big deal. The orange juice in the lobby is quite tasty; they could offer more. However, people often spill it everywhere, and it's not always cleaned up. The cleaning staff would knock on doors every midday reminding guests to check out. Sometimes I had extended my stay, but they would still remind me to check out. There's a communication gap between the front desk and cleaning staff that needs to be resolved. Also, it would be even better if they could provide hangers! Initially, I thought the men's and women's sections were completely separate, but it turns out they share the same entrance/exit and laundry room. Or sometimes, turning a corner in the residential area, you might unexpectedly encounter someone of the opposite sex, which can be startling. This particular branch seems to only have single rooms, unlike other branches that offer dormitory beds, which is good. It offers better safety and hygiene (though it's also more expensive than a dorm bed). It would be great if the vending machine could also sell simple foldable shower slippers or tissues. I had to order these through delivery or buy them at a supermarket, which was a bit pricey. If the hotel procured them in bulk, it could offer better convenience. That's all.

To catch Jolin's concert, I specifically picked this hotel from several options nearby for a place to rest and park. The Beichen hotel had the best facilities, but it was a bit far to walk and pricey. The Grand Skylight was the closest but only a 4-star. So, I opted for the 5-star Crowne Plaza Wuzhou, which is quite close to the Bird's Nest. You can actually walk to the venue in about 10-odd minutes if you're quick. **Facilities:** The facilities and room types felt a bit dated, and the air conditioning was an older model, but it cooled effectively. The main drawback was the lack of USB ports, which feels a bit behind the times. **Cleanliness:** Very clean. **Environment:** The hotel was full of foreigners, so I imagine it must be a pretty good value option for them. **Service:** The front desk attendant upgraded my room, and from the window, I could see both the Bird's Nest, the Olympic Tower (nail tower), and Pangu Plaza—it was fantastic! Plus, free 24-hour parking for guests was a huge bonus for concert-goers. Thumbs up, thumbs up, thumbs up!
